The Bridgeton Covered Bridge FestivalThe Bridgeton Covered Bridge Festival

Parke County is home to 32 covered bridges and Indiana's greatest fall festival    This 10 day event always starts on the 2nd Friday of October.

It started in 1957 and has grown to become one of the largest festivals in the country.

Over 2 million visitors are estimated to visit Parke County during this county wide event.


The Parke County Covered Bridge Festival

   The Historic Bridgeton Mill is one of the main attractions in the county.

There are over 600 Arts, Crafts, Antiques and Who Knows What booths in the town of Bridgeton for this 10 day event.

The mill property has around 150 booth spaces that are located around the covered bridge and mill.
